I've got a brand new Dell Core Duo desktop machine running 64-bit Vista Home Premium. I have Cubase 5 installed, and the About Box shows version 5.0.0 Build 82 - Built on Dec 12 2008. I checked your website for downloads, but it appears there are no updates available, just documentation.

I've done the following:

* Unplugged all USB devices except keyboard, mouse and CC121. It is directly connected using the short USB cable included with the product, but turned off. The AC adapter is plugged in.
* Rebooted machine
* Installed the 64-bit CC121 extensions verion 1.1.0, which I downloaded from your website
* Copied the DLL to C:\Program Files\Common Files\Steinberg\Shared Components
* Turned on the CC121 (All lights come on and then fade out. Cubase Ready light just blinks.)
* Let Windows install the Yamaha MIDI driver from the CD, as per the instructions
* Turned off CC121
* Inserted Cubase USB key
* Rebooted
* Turned on CC121 (All lights come on and then fade out. Cubase Ready light just blinks. Windows "Device connected" sound plays.)
* Verified that it shows as connected when I open the Yamaha USB MIDI driver control panel app
* Opened Cubase 5, starting a new project (8 mono audio, 4 stereo audio)
* Cubase Ready light on CC121 still just blinks, and none of the controls do anything, nor do any other lights light up
* Went into Device Manager, and tried alternately turning on and off CC121 in MIDI Port Setup for both input and output. When I check the checkbox for the CC121 it shows as "active". Still doesn't work.
* Went into Device Manager, and tried alternately turning on and off CC121 in Quick Controls MIDI input and output. Still doesn't work.
* Went into Help->Documentation->Remote Control Devices and found that CC121 is not mentioned anywhere.
